Choose dstack if…
- dstack is primarily Python; flyte is Go.
- License: dstack is MPL-2.0, flyte is Apache-2.0.
- Tags unique to dstack: agent-skills, agentic-orchestration, amd, cloud.
- Also covers Inference & Serving.
- If your project requires support for multiple hardware vendors such as NVIDIA, AMD, TPU, or Tenstorrent
When NOT to use dstack
- When sticking to single-vendor solutions where tightly integrated proprietary tools are preferred
- If the project strictly avoids open-source components with Mozilla Public License (MPL-2.0)
Choose flyte if…
- flyte is primarily Go; dstack is Python.
- License: flyte is Apache-2.0, dstack is MPL-2.0.
- Tags unique to flyte: agentic, ai-agents, ai-development-tools, data-analysis.
- Also covers Data & Retrieval, Developer Tools.
- flyte ships Docker support for self-hosted deployment.
- You need robust orchestration for deploying machine learning pipelines in production environments with dynamic scaling.
When NOT to use flyte
- If your organization strictly uses Python-based environments without plans to integrate Go or GRPC, Flyte's utility may be diminished.
- For smaller-scale projects that do not require high levels of scalability or complexity in orchestration, using Flyte might introduce unnecessary overhead.
